Saturday, October 27, 2012

Sushi Chefs vs. Giant Monsters

Oof. I hate it when I go for long stretches without updates but unfortunately I’ve been insanely busy over these last few months. Allow me to make amends by bringing your attention to this awesome short film I recently came across called Monster Roll:

You can also check out the movie's home page complete with “behind the scenes” goodies: